Chapter 9 Troubleshooting Tables

9.1

Power-Up Error Codes

During radio power-up, the radio performs dynamic tests to determine if the radio is working properly.
Problems detected during these tests are presented as an error code on the radio’s display. The
presence of an error code should prompt a user that a problem exists and that a service technician
should be contacted. Use

Table 9-1

to aid in understanding particular operational error codes.

9.2

Operational Error Codes

During radio operation, the radio performs dynamic tests to determine if the radio is working properly.
Problems detected during these tests are presented as an error code on the radio’s display. The
presence of an error code should prompt a user that a problem exists and that a service technician
should be contacted. Use

Table 9-2

to aid in understanding particular operational error codes.

Table 9-1. Power-Up Error Code Display

Error Code

Possible Causes

Corrective Action

RAM ERR

RAM Test Failure

Retest radio by turning if off and tuning it on again. If
message reoccurs, replace main board or send radio to
depot.

ROM ERR

ROM checksum is wrong

Reprogram FLASH memory and retest. If message reoc-
curs, replace main board or send radio to depot.

EPRM ERR

EEPROM Hardware Error –
Codeplug structure mismatch
or non-existence of code-
plug or,
EEPROM Checksum Error –
Codeplug checksum is
wrong

Reprogram codeplug with correct codeplug and retest. If
message reoccurs, replace main board or send radio to
depot.

Table 9-2. Operational Error Code Display

Error Code

Possible Causes

Corrective Action

SYN UNLK

Synthesizer Out-of-Lock

Verify codeplug and reprogram if necessary. If message
reoccurs, replace main board or send radio to depot.
